This site is using the standard WordPress Theme Unit Test Data for content. The Theme Unit Test is a series of posts and pages that match up with a checklist on the WordPress codex. You can use the data and checklist together to test your theme. It is recommended that you test your theme with the Theme Unit Test before submitting your theme to the WordPress.org theme directory.

WordPress Theme Development Resources

  1. See the WordPress Theme Developer Handbook for examples of best practices.
  2. See the WordPress Code Reference for more information about WordPress’ functions, classes, methods, and hooks.
  3. See Theme Unit Test for a robust test suite for your Theme and get the latest version of the test data you see here.
  4. See Releasing Your Theme for a guide to submitting your Theme to the Theme Directory.
